Previously, the union recommended common sense measures that SSA should adopt immediately:
1. return to telework for all components & let all employees work from home: particularly the SSA employees in field offices & card centers
2. SSA put up signage at every office alerting members of the public that if they are experiencing symptoms they should not enter the building but call the 800 number
3. SSA field employees be directed to handle all issues over the phone to reduce public contact & exposure.
You flatly denied every single one of the common sense measures the union suggested weeks ago. In fact, your agents James Julian & Jack Leiby have smugly told the union NO over the last several weeks.
The union now requests that you immediately close all field offices & card centers for a period of no less than 14 days.
During a White House briefing today (March 15), Dr. Fauci clearly stated the White House position; “I don’t think it’s a good idea to congregate anybody anywhere,” Dr. Fauci said on CBS’s Face the Nation.
He also stated that EVERYONE should practice “social distancing” which means staying at least SIX feet away from anyone else at all times.
It’s impossible to carry out the White House’s instructions if you do not close Field Offices & Card Centers.
By keeping Field Offices & Card Centers open, you are deliberately & willfully jeopardizing the health & safety of the employees & the American people whom we serve.
It should be noted that states & municipalities have taken the extraordinary measures of ordering privately owned businesses to close early and/or limit their operations to only one-half of their capacity. In some cases, privately owned businesses have been ordered closed to prevent the spread of this pandemic.
